In the realm of Digital Land Economics, the dichotomy between scarcity and infinite space is a key concept to understand. Traditional land is finite, its value often linked to location, size, and the limited availability. On the digital front, however, the perception of space is boundless, seemingly allowing for infinite expansion. This infinite digital space challenges the traditional economic principles of scarcity, yet it also introduces new dynamics such as digital real estate, virtual land ownership, and the valuation of online experiences. As we navigate this digital landscape, it's crucial to recognize that while digital space may feel limitless, the value placed on digital assets can still be scarce due to factors like desirability, utility, and the network effects that drive demand and exclusivity.
